(from The Cook's Own Book and Housekeeper's Register, by N. K. M. Lee, 1842)
Ingredients:
turnip tops
a small handful of salt
Instructions:
TURNIP TOPS Are the shoots which grow out (in the spring) of the old turnip. Put them into cold water an hour before they are to be dressed; the more water they are boiled in, the better they will look; if boiled in a small quantity of water, they will taste bitter; when the water boils, put in a small handful of salt, and then your vegetables; if fresh and young, they will be done in about twenty minutes; drain them on the back of a sieve.
